Sorts Of L1 Visas





Multiple kinds of L1 visas accommodate the diverse requirements of international firms aiming to transfer workers to the USA. Both primary classifications of L1 visas are L1A and L1B, each developed for particular duties and obligations within an organization. L1 Visa Requirements.The L1A visa is planned for managers and executives. This group permits companies to transfer individuals that hold supervisory or executive settings, allowing them to manage procedures in the united state. This visa stands for a first period of as much as three years, with the opportunity of extensions for a total of approximately 7 years. The L1A visa is particularly valuable for companies seeking to develop a strong leadership visibility in the U.S. market.On the various other hand, the L1B visa is designated for workers with specialized understanding. This includes individuals who possess sophisticated experience in details locations, such as proprietary modern technologies or unique procedures within the company. The L1B visa is additionally valid for a first three-year period, with expansions available for as much as 5 years. This visa group is suitable for companies that need workers with specialized skills to improve their operations and maintain an one-upmanship in the U.S.Both L1A and L1B visas permit for double intent, indicating that visa holders can obtain irreversible residency while on the visa. Comprehending the distinctions between these two classifications is important for businesses planning to navigate the intricacies of staff member transfers to the USA properly


Eligibility Needs



To get an L1 visa, both the employer and the worker must meet certain qualification standards established by united state immigration authorities. The L1 visa is created for intra-company transferees, enabling international firms to transfer employees to their united state offices.First, the company should be a certifying organization, which means it should have a parent business, branch, subsidiary, or associate that is doing organization both in the united state and in the foreign country. This connection is crucial for demonstrating that the worker is being transferred within the exact same company framework. The company has to likewise have been doing company for at the very least one year in both locations.Second, the worker must have been employed by the international company for a minimum of one continuous year within the three years coming before the application. This employment has to be in a supervisory, executive, or specialized understanding ability. For L1A visas, which accommodate supervisors and execs, the staff member must show that they will certainly continue to run in a similar capacity in the united state For L1B visas, meant for employees with specialized knowledge, the private need to possess one-of-a-kind competence that adds significantly to the business's operations.


Application Process



Navigating the application procedure for an L1 visa involves a number of vital steps that need to be completed precisely to ensure a successful result. The primary step is to determine the suitable classification of the L1 visa: L1A for supervisors and executives, or L1B for workers with specialized understanding. This distinction is substantial, as it impacts the paperwork required.Once the group is determined, the united state company need to submit Kind I-129, Application for a Nonimmigrant Employee. This form ought to consist of detailed info concerning the business, the employee's duty, and the nature of the work to be carried out in the U.S. Accompanying documentation normally consists of proof of the connection in between the united state and international entities, proof of the worker's certifications, and information concerning the job offer.After submission, the U.S. Citizenship and Migration Provider (USCIS) will certainly evaluate the petition. If accepted, the staff member will certainly be alerted, and they can after that apply for the visa at an U.S. consulate or consular office in their home country. This involves completing Form DS-160, the Online Nonimmigrant copyright, and setting up an interview.During the meeting, the applicant should provide numerous records, including the accepted Type I-129, evidence of work, and any additional supporting proof. Complying with the meeting, if the visa is given, the worker will certainly receive a visa stamp in their key, permitting them to get in the united state to benefit the funding company. Proper prep work and thorough documentation are key to navigating this process efficiently.
